Why Your Current SEO Dashboard Is Missing the Most Important Metric

If your SEO reporting still centers on organic clicks, sessions, and keyword rankings, you are measuring the wrong thing in 2026. Google AI Overviews now appear on approximately 68% of searches. That means for more than two-thirds of queries, the most important real estate on the page is an AI-generated answer. Not your blue link at position 1.

The good news: Google Search Console now surfaces AI Overview impression data. The bad news: most marketing teams have not set up the filters to see it.

This guide walks through the exact process, step by step, to track AI Overview impressions, measure citation performance, and build a zero-click visibility dashboard that gives you an accurate picture of your brand's AI search presence.

What Google Search Console Now Tracks for AI Overviews

As of 2026, Google Search Console's Performance report includes a Search type filter that separates AI Overview data from standard web search data. The key metrics available are:

MetricWhat It MeasuresWhy It Matters
AI Overview ImpressionsHow many times your content appeared as a cited source in an AI OverviewMeasures zero-click brand exposure
AI Overview ClicksHow many times a user clicked your citation link within an AI OverviewMeasures AI-driven referral traffic
AI Overview CTRClick-through rate from AI Overview citationsBenchmarks citation quality
AI Overview PositionAverage ranking position of your cited contentTracks citation authority over time

Important distinction: A page can appear in an AI Overview (generating an impression) without appearing in the standard organic results, and vice versa. These are separate visibility channels that require separate measurement.

Step-by-Step: Setting Up AI Overview Tracking in Search Console

Step 1: Access the Performance Report

  1. Log in to Google Search Console
  2. Select your property from the left-hand dropdown
  3. Click Performance in the left navigation
  4. Select Search results (not Discover or News)

Step 2: Filter by Search Type

This is the critical step most marketers miss:

  1. Click the + New button at the top of the filter bar
  2. Select Search type
  3. Choose AI Overviews from the dropdown
  4. Click Apply

You will now see impressions, clicks, CTR, and position data specifically for queries where your content was cited in an AI Overview.

Step 3: Set Your Date Range

For meaningful trend analysis:

  • Set the date range to Last 3 months for baseline establishment
  • Use Compare mode to compare the last 28 days against the previous 28 days to spot trends
  • Export monthly snapshots to a spreadsheet for longitudinal tracking

Step 4: Analyze the Queries Tab

Switch to the Queries tab to see which specific search queries are triggering AI Overview citations for your content. Sort by Impressions (descending) to find your highest-visibility queries.

What to look for:

  • Queries with high impressions but zero clicks, these are your zero-click citation wins
  • Queries where you have AI Overview impressions but low standard organic impressions, these are pages winning AI visibility without traditional ranking
  • Queries where competitors appear in AI Overviews but you do not, these are content gaps to address

Step 5: Analyze the Pages Tab

Switch to the Pages tab to identify which pages on your site are generating AI Overview citations. This tells you:

  • Which content formats are most citation-worthy (FAQs, how-tos, data-backed articles)
  • Which topic clusters have AI visibility vs. which are invisible to AI
  • Which pages to prioritize for schema markup and content updates

Building a Zero-Click Visibility Dashboard

Once you have the raw data, the next step is building a dashboard that tracks zero-click performance over time. Here is the recommended structure:

Dashboard Section 1: AI Overview Headline Metrics

Track these four numbers weekly:

  1. Total AI Overview impressions (week-over-week change)
  2. Total AI Overview clicks (week-over-week change)
  3. AI Overview CTR (benchmark: 2–5% is typical for AI Overview citations)
  4. Number of unique queries generating AI Overview impressions

Dashboard Section 2: Top Cited Pages

A ranked table of your top 10 pages by AI Overview impressions, updated monthly. This shows which content is earning AI citations and which needs attention.

Dashboard Section 3: Query Coverage Map

Map your target keywords against AI Overview impression data to identify:

  • Covered queries: Keywords where you have AI Overview impressions
  • Gap queries: Keywords where competitors have AI Overview presence but you do not
  • Opportunity queries: High-volume queries with no current AI Overview citation from anyone in your category

Dashboard Section 4: Brand Citation Monitoring (Beyond Search Console)

Search Console only tracks Google. For complete zero-click visibility measurement, add manual citation audits for:

  • ChatGPT: Test your top 10 category queries in ChatGPT and note which brands are cited
  • Gemini: Same process in Google Gemini
  • Perplexity: Same process in Perplexity AI
  • Bing Copilot: Same process in Microsoft Copilot

Run this audit monthly and track your share of voice across all four platforms. A simple spreadsheet with query, platform, cited brands, and your position is sufficient.

Interpreting Your AI Overview Data: What Good Looks Like

Benchmarks for AI Overview Performance

MetricEarly Stage (0–3 months)Growing (3–6 months)Established (6+ months)
AI Overview impressions100–1,000/month1,000–10,000/month10,000+/month
Queries with impressions5–2020–100100+
AI Overview CTR1–2%2–4%4–6%
Pages generating citations1–55–2020+

Red Flags to Watch For

  • Impressions dropping week-over-week: May indicate a content freshness issue or a competitor publishing more authoritative content on the same topic
  • High impressions, zero clicks: Normal for informational queries (the AI answered it fully) but worth monitoring for commercial queries where you want the click
  • Pages with strong organic rankings but zero AI Overview impressions: These pages likely lack FAQPage schema or answer-first content structure, prime candidates for optimization

The Three-Step Optimization Loop

Once you have your tracking in place, the optimization process is straightforward:

Step 1: Identify, Use the Pages tab to find high-traffic pages with zero AI Overview impressions

Step 2: Optimise, Add FAQPage schema, restructure the opening paragraph to lead with a direct answer, and update the dateModified field in your Article schema

Step 3: Measure, Wait 4–6 weeks (Google's typical re-crawl and re-evaluation cycle for schema changes) and check whether AI Overview impressions have appeared for the target queries

Repeat this loop monthly across your top content cluster pages. Most sites see their first AI Overview impressions within 6–8 weeks of implementing FAQPage schema on well-structured content.

What to Report to Stakeholders

The hardest part of zero-click measurement is explaining its value to stakeholders who are used to click-based ROI. Here is the framing that works:

"AI Overview impressions are the equivalent of a billboard on the most-travelled road in your category. The user may not stop today, but they see your brand. When they are ready to buy, you are already in their consideration set. We track this as brand exposure at zero marginal cost."

Report AI Overview impressions alongside branded search volume (available in the standard Search Console Performance report filtered by brand queries). The correlation between rising AI Overview impressions and rising branded search volume is the clearest evidence of zero-click brand building working.

Connecting the Measurement to Content Strategy

The data from this dashboard should directly inform your editorial calendar:

  • Queries with high AI Overview impressions but no clicks: Publish a deeper companion piece that earns the click for users who want more than the AI summary
  • Queries where competitors are cited but you are not: Publish a more authoritative, schema-marked piece on the same topic
  • Queries where you have impressions but low position: Update the cited page with fresher data, more comprehensive schema, and a stronger opening answer

This creates a feedback loop where your Search Console data drives content decisions, which drives more AI Overview citations, which drives more brand visibility, compounding over time.

The brands that build this measurement infrastructure now will have 12–18 months of compounding citation data before their competitors realise they should be tracking it.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can you track AI Overview impressions in Google Search Console?

Yes. Google Search Console's Performance report includes a Search type filter that separates AI Overview data from standard web search. Filter by 'AI Overviews' to see impressions, clicks, CTR, and position data specifically for queries where your content was cited in an AI Overview.

What is a good AI Overview CTR benchmark?

A typical AI Overview CTR is 2–5%. This is lower than standard organic CTR because many users are satisfied by the AI-generated answer and do not click through. However, AI Overview citations still generate brand impressions and authority transfer even without a click.

How long does it take to see AI Overview impressions after adding schema?

Most sites see their first AI Overview impressions within 4 to 8 weeks of implementing FAQPage schema on well-structured, answer-first content. Google's typical re-crawl and re-evaluation cycle for schema changes runs 4 to 6 weeks. Accelerate this by submitting updated URLs via Google Search Console's URL Inspection tool immediately after deployment, and by ensuring FAQ answers are 60 to 80 words with a direct answer in the first sentence.

How do you track AI Overview citations on ChatGPT and Gemini?

Search Console only tracks Google AI Overviews. For ChatGPT, Gemini, Perplexity, and Bing Copilot, you need to run manual citation audits, testing your top 10 category queries in each platform monthly and tracking which brands are cited. A simple spreadsheet tracking query, platform, cited brands, and your position is sufficient.

What does a high AI Overview impression count with zero clicks mean?

High impressions with zero clicks is normal for informational queries where the AI fully answers the question. It represents zero-click brand exposure, the user saw your brand cited as the source without needing to visit your site. This builds brand recall and consideration, particularly for B2B buyers in early research phases.
